Twitter LinkedIn Facebook Pinterest Telegram WhatsApp Yammer Reddit TeamsRecent ChangesSend via e-MailPrintPermalink × Table of Contents Package Config file server_names Anonymized DNS Start/restart DNSCrypt DNSCrypt is a protocol that encrypts, authenticates and optionally anonymizes communications between a DNS client and a DNS resolver. It prevents DNS spoofing. It uses cryptographic signatures to verify that responses originate from the chosen DNS resolver and haven’t been tampered with. It is an open specification, with free and open source reference implementations, and it is not affiliated with any company nor organization. Package pacman -S dnscrypt-proxy Check also the link for other devices. Config file Change your dnscrypt-proxy.toml config file. nano /etc/dnscrypt-proxy/dnscrypt-proxy.toml server_names server_names = ['techsaviours.org-dnscrypt'] Anonymized DNS Go to the bottom routes = [ and add: routes = [ { server_name='2.dnscrypt-cert.techsaviours.org', via=['anon-techsaviours.org'] } ] Start/restart systemctl enable --now dnscrypt-proxy.service Any changes to /etc/dnscrypt-proxy/dnscrypt-proxy.toml requires a restart of the service. Keep that in mind.systemctl restart dnscrypt-proxy.service 2022/04/16 21:47 · dan en/desktop/services/dnscrypt.txt Last modified: 2022/04/16 21:49by dan
